+# Test that Linux kernel boots on ppc machines and check the console
+#
+# Copyright (c) 2018, 2020 Red Hat, Inc.
+#
+# This work is licensed under the terms of the GNU GPL, version 2 or
+# later. See the COPYING file in the top-level directory.
+
+from avocado.utils import archive
+from avocado_qemu import QemuSystemTest
+from avocado_qemu import wait_for_console_pattern
+
+class pseriesMachine(QemuSystemTest):
+
+ timeout = 90
+ KERNEL_COMMON_COMMAND_LINE = 'printk.time=0 '
+ panic_message = 'Kernel panic - not syncing'
+
+ def test_ppc64_pseries(self):
+ """
+ :avocado: tags=arch:ppc64
+ :avocado: tags=machine:pseries
+ """
+ kernel_url = ('https://archives.fedoraproject.org/pub/archive'
+ '/fedora-secondary/releases/29/Everything/ppc64le/os'
+ '/ppc/ppc64/vmlinuz')
+ kernel_hash = '3fe04abfc852b66653b8c3c897a59a689270bc77'
+ kernel_path = self.fetch_asset(kernel_url, asset_hash=kernel_hash)
+
+ self.vm.set_console()
+ kernel_command_line = self.KERNEL_COMMON_COMMAND_LINE + 'console=hvc0'
+ self.vm.add_args('-kernel', kernel_path,
+ '-append', kernel_command_line)
+ self.vm.launch()
+ console_pattern = 'Kernel command line: %s' % kernel_command_line
+ wait_for_console_pattern(self, console_pattern, self.panic_message)
